Spicy Honey Ginger Chicken Bowls

A delightful fusion of ginger, honey, and tender chicken, served over fluffy rice and vibrant vegetables for a comforting and flavorful meal.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ine Asian, Fusion
Servings 4 servings
Calories 550 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ts Tender and juicy, these chicken breasts are the star of your dish.
  • 2 tbsp olive oil Adds a rich, fruity flavor and ensures perfect searing.
  • 1 tbsp fresh ginger, grated Infuses the dish with delightful warmth.
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ced Adds depth to the flavor profile.
  • 1/4 cup honey Balances spicy elements for a well-rounded taste.
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ce Brings umami richness to the dish.
  • 1 tbsp rice vinegar Adds a splash of tanginess to brighten flavors.
  • 1 tsp sriracha sauce For an added kick of heat.
  • 1 tsp sesame oil Adds a nutty flavor to the dish.
  • 2 cups cooked rice Serves as the base for chicken and vegetables.
  • 1 cup steamed broccoli Adds color and fiber.
  • 1 piece carrot, julienned Sweet and crunchy, enhances texture.
  • 2 tbsp sesame seeds Provides a delightful crunch.
  • to taste fresh cilantro for garnish Enhances visual appeal and adds freshness.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Season chicken breasts generously with salt and pepper.
  • Sear chicken breasts for about 6-7 minutes per side until golden brown.
  • In a bowl, whisk together honey, ginger, garlic, soy sauce, rice vinegar, sriracha, and sesame oil.

Cooking

  • Once chicken is cooked through, pour the honey ginger sauce over it.
  • Reduce heat to low and let the sauce simmer for 3-4 minutes to thicken.
  • Remove chicken from skillet, slice it into strips, and set aside.

Assembly

  • Begin with a base of cooked rice in each bowl.
  • Layer on steamed broccoli and julienned carrots.
  • Top with sliced chicken and drizzle remaining sauce over the chicken.
  • Sprinkle with sesame seeds and garnish with fresh cilantro.

Notes

Rest chicken after cooking for better juiciness. Ensure sauce thickens to develop flavor.
